P
El Comienzo Noticias Recetas
Menu
×

Entendiendo los Balanceadores de Carga en Windows

Los balanceadores de carga son herramientas cruciales para garantizar el funcionamiento eficiente de las aplicaciones y servicios dentro de un entorno informático. Microsoft Windows ofrece soluciones integradas para este propósito, que aseguran un reparto efectivo de la carga de trabajo entre los servidores disponibles, maximizando el rendimiento y minimizando tiempos de inactividad. A continuación, exploraremos cómo funcionan los balanceadores de carga de Windows, sus características y las mejores prácticas para su implementación.

¿Qué son los Balanceadores de Carga y Cómo Funcionan en Windows?

Un balanceador de carga es un dispositivo que distribuye el tráfico de red o carga de trabajo de manera equitativa entre múltiples servidores o recursos de computación. En un entorno Windows, estas herramientas permiten que aplicaciones web, bases de datos y otros servicios funcionen de manera fluida frente a variaciones en el tráfico o carga de trabajo.

El principio básico detrás de un balanceador de carga de Windows es asegurarse de que ninguna máquina se sature gestionando proceso excesivos. En lugar de que un solo servidor maneje todas las peticiones, el balanceador distribuye estas entre varios servidores para optimizar el uso de recursos.

Un balanceador puede estar configurado para manejar diferentes tipos de tráfico, como rutas de HTTP, HTTPS, TCP y UDP, entre otros. Esto es fundamental para garantizar un rendimiento óptimo para servicios web, servicios de bases de datos, aplicaciones personalizadas y más, independientemente del tipo de protocolo en uso.

Características Clave de los Balanceadores de Carga en Windows

Los balanceadores de carga en Windows vienen con una variedad de características que los hacen eficaces en la gestión de tráfico. Algunas de las funcionalidades más relevantes incluyen:

  • Auto-escalabilidad: Permite añadir o quitar servidores según la demanda actual, asegurando que se manejen eficientemente los picos de tráfico.
  • Monitoreo de la Salud: Los balanceadores verifican regularmente la salud de los servidores. Si alguno falla, las solicitudes se dirigen automáticamente a otros servidores activos.
  • Redundancia y alta disponibilidad: Se implementan configuraciones de redundancia, de modo que si un balanceador falla, otro toma el control, minimizando tiempos de inactividad.
  • Flexibilidad en la distribución del tráfico: Se pueden definir reglas personalizadas para gestionar cómo se distribuye el tráfico, adaptándose a las necesidades específicas de cada aplicación.

Estas características son esenciales para empresas que implementan aplicaciones críticas en sus entornos Windows y buscan mantener una operatividad continua y sin problemas.

Mejores Prácticas para la Implementación de Balanceadores de Carga en Windows

Para maximizar el rendimiento y eficacia de los balanceadores de carga en Windows, es crucial seguir ciertas prácticas recomendadas:

  1. Evaluación de Necesidades de Carga: Antes de implementar, realiza una evaluación exhaustiva de tus necesidades actuales y futuras en relación al tráfico y carga de trabajo. Esto ayudará a dimensionar adecuadamente los recursos de balanceo.

  2. Configuración de Monitorización Adecuada: Activa herramientas de monitoreo que brinden estadísticas y alertas en tiempo real sobre el rendimiento del sistema. Esto facilita decisiones rápidas y efectivas en caso de caídas.

  3. Regular Pruebas de Rendimiento y de Fallo: Implementa pruebas de carga regulares para asegurarte de que el balanceo está funcionando de manera óptima. Simula fallos para verificar que la infraestructura sea resistente.

  4. Uso de Múltiples Balanceadores: En casos críticos, la implementación de múltiples balanceadores mejora la disponibilidad y distribuye las cargas de manera uniforme incluso si alguno de los dispositivos falla.

  5. Optimización Continua: Analiza periódicamente el tráfico y ajusta las reglas de distribución para mejorar la eficiencia del sistema basado en las tendencias más recientes observadas.

La correcta implementación y gestión de los balanceadores de carga puede hacer una diferencia significativa en la eficiencia de las aplicaciones, asegurando un servicio constante y de calidad. Con estas prácticas, las organizaciones pueden optimizar sus operaciones y garantizar una experiencia de usuario positiva.


Artículos que podrían interesarte:

Gestión de parches de Windows: Guía Completa de Sistemas de Administración

Plataforma de Respuesta a Incidentes Kanban: Eficiencia y Organización

Herramientas Ágiles para la Migración a la Nube

Herramientas de Asignación de Recursos en Seguridad Informática: Optimizando la Protección

Plataformas de Respuesta a Incidentes en Linux: Herramientas y Mejores Prácticas

Escáneres de Vulnerabilidades en Linux: Una Herramienta Esencial para la Seguridad Informática

Gestión de dispositivos móviles con ITIL: Optimización y eficiencia

Herramientas de Migración de Aplicaciones Móviles a la Nube

Herramientas de Virtualización para la Seguridad IT: Innovación y Protección

Herramientas de Virtualización en DevOps: Claves para el Éxito Tecnológico

API Gateways en Windows: Optimización y Mejores Prácticas

Planificación de Recursos: Sistemas de Registro

Sistemas Ágiles de Registro: Transformando la Gestión de Datos

Gestión de Microservicios en la Seguridad de Redes

Herramientas de Migración a la Nube con Scrum: Guía Completa

Soluciones De Prevención De Pérdida De Datos En Windows: Protección Efectiva Para Su Información

Gestión de Sistemas de Pruebas de Planificación de Recursos

Importancia y Herramientas de Virtualización en DevOps

Optimización de Carga en la Nube con Balanceadores de Carga en CloudOps

Herramientas Esenciales: Monitoreo de TI con Dashboards

Herramientas de Gestión de Contenedores ITIL: Maximiza la Eficiencia

Herramientas de Asignación de Recursos en DevOps: Optimización y Eficiencia

Orquestación de Sistemas ITIL: Optimización y Eficiencia

Gestión de Microservicios con Kanban: Mejores Prácticas y Ventajas

Sistemas de Registro en Linux: Clave para un Monitoreo Eficiente